Miami Heat coach Erik Spoelstra rarely uses profanity when answering questions during interviews.
But he couldn't help himself when asked about the many analysts who are picking the Boston Celtics to win the series. No team has ever rallied from 3-0 deficit but the Celtics can move one step closer with a victory tonight in Game 5 of the Eastern Conference finals.
"We don't give a shit," Spoelstra said. "We're trying to compete. This is a great opportunity and our guys love these kind of challenges, love to compete, love the playoffs, love playing in an environment like this. This is what it's about. It's not about getting ahead of it. You want to be present for the competitive nature of what we can expect tonight. That's how our guys are wired."
